The English language is forever changing. New words appear; old ones fall out of use
or change their meanings. World Wide Words tries to record at least some part of this shifting
wordscape by featuring new words, word histories, the background to words in the news,
and the curiosities of native English speech.
This site is the archive of pieces that have appeared in the free e-magazine.
Weekly issues include much more than appears here, including discussion by readers,
serendipitous encounters with unfamiliar language, and tongue-in-cheek
tut-tuttings at errors perpetrated by sloppy writers.
